Lets compare vitamin content per 1 pound of Apples vs Boiled Kidney Beans:
Raw Apples with skin have 3.8 times more Vitamin C and 6 times more Vitamin E than Boiled All Types Kidney Beans.
While Boiled All Types Kidney Beans contain 9.4 times more Vitamin B1, 2.2 times more Vitamin B2, 6.4 times more Vitamin B3, 3.6 times more Vitamin B5, 2.9 times more Vitamin B6, 43.3 times more Vitamin B9 and 3.8 times more Vitamin K than Raw Apples with skin.
Both Raw Apples with skin as well as Boiled All Types Kidney Beans have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in 1 lb.
Comparing minerals per 1 pound for Apples vs Boiled Kidney Beans:
Raw Apples with skin have 1.3 times more Water than Boiled All Types Kidney Beans.
While Boiled All Types Kidney Beans contain 5.8 times more Calcium, 8 times more Copper, 18.5 times more Iron, 8.4 times more Magnesium, 12.3 times more Manganese, 12.5 times more Phosphorus, 3.8 times more Potassium, more Selenium and 25 times more Zinc than Raw Apples with skin.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 pound:
Raw Apples with skin have 32.5 times more Sugars than Boiled All Types Kidney Beans.
While Boiled All Types Kidney Beans contain 2.4 times more Energy, 18.9 times more Omega 3, 1.7 times more Carbohydrate, 2.7 times more Fiber and 33.3 times more Protein than Raw Apples with skin.
Both Raw Apples with skin as well as Boiled All Types Kidney Beans have insufficient amounts of Fat, Omega 6, Cholesterol, Glucose and Sucrose in 1 lb.
